Kalakhal F.V. Population - Cachar, Assam
Kalakhal F.V. is a medium size village located in Sonai Circle of Cachar district, Assam with total 68 families residing. The Kalakhal F.V. village has population of 357 of which 176 are males while 181 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kalakhal F.V. village population of children with age 0-6 is 58 which makes up 16.25 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kalakhal F.V. village is 1028 which is higher than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Kalakhal F.V. as per census is 933, lower than Assam average of 962.
Kalakhal F.V. village has higher liter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Kalakhal F.V. village was 90.97 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Kalakhal F.V. Male literacy stands at 91.10 % while female literacy rate was 90.85 %.

Kalakhal F.V.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 68 | - | - |
Population | 357 | 176 | 181 |
Child (0-6) | 58 | 30 | 28 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 352 | 171 | 181 |
Literacy | 90.97 % | 91.10 % | 90.85 % |
Total Workers | 195 | 96 | 99 |
Main Worker | 68 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 127 | 40 | 87 |
